Simarouba amara (marupa) is Neotropical species belonging to the family Simaroubaceae. This specie have historically been used in folk medicine to treat conditions such as malaria, cancer, helminthiasis, viral infections, gastritis, ulcers, diarrhea, and diabetes. However, the absence of next-generation sequencing-based microsatellite markers (SSR-Seq) for S. amara has limited our understanding of their evolutionary history and genetic diversity. Recent advances in high-throughput sequencing technologies have improved the acquisition of genomic datasets for wild species. In this study, we generated, for the first time, high-quality draft assemblies for the specie, and mined SSR-Seq markers from these assemblies.
